The best high-fiber protein bars (and the fiber trap)
Protein bars solved the protein problem and then noticed that fiber sells too. The result is an aisle full of bars advertising double-digit fiber counts, most of which come from a small set of manufactured fibers that behave very differently from the fiber in a bowl of lentils. Some of them are genuinely useful. Some will ruin your afternoon. The good news is that you can tell which is which from the ingredients list in about five seconds, once you know what to look for.
Quick Answer
Read the fiber source, not the fiber number. Bars built on chicory root inulin or soluble corn fiber deliver real fiber but ferment heavily, so a 15g bar can cause serious bloating - go half a bar to start. Bars built on IMO (isomalto-oligosaccharide) are the ones to be most sceptical of; research suggests a substantial share of it is digested like a sugar rather than acting as fiber, which means the label number overstates what you're getting. The best-tolerated bars get their fiber from whole ingredients - dates, nuts, oats, seeds - and typically land at 5-10g rather than 15g. That smaller honest number is usually worth more than the big one.
The four fiber sources you'll see on a bar
| Ingredient | What it is | Real fiber? | Gut tolerance |
|---|---|---|---|
| Dates, nuts, oats, seeds | Whole-food fiber | Yes, intact | Best |
| Chicory root inulin | Extracted prebiotic fiber | Yes | Heavy fermenter - gas |
| Soluble corn fiber | Manufactured from corn starch | Yes | Moderate, generally better than inulin |
| IMO (isomalto-oligosaccharide) | Syrup marketed as fiber | Partly - much is digested as sugar | Variable, and the label misleads |
Whole-food fiber
Dates, figs, almonds, oats, chia. It arrives with everything that naturally accompanies fiber - polyphenols, minerals, a food matrix that slows digestion - and your gut handles it the way it has handled fiber forever. The downside is that it's bulky, so bars built this way rarely exceed 5-10g. That's a real 5-10g.
Chicory root inulin
The most common way to make a bar's fiber number large. Inulin is a legitimate prebiotic with real evidence behind it, and it's also completely fermented by gut bacteria - meaning gas. A bar with 12g of inulin is a substantial fermentation load delivered in ninety seconds, which is not how anyone evolved to eat fiber. This is the single most common reason people say high-fiber bars destroy their stomach.
Soluble corn fiber
Manufactured from corn starch, widely used, and generally better tolerated than inulin at the same dose. It counts as fiber and is treated as such by regulators. Reasonable middle ground.
IMO - the one to watch
Isomalto-oligosaccharide became popular in low-carb bars because it let manufacturers subtract a large number from net carbs. Research since then indicates a substantial portion of IMO is actually digested and absorbed like a sugar rather than reaching the colon as fiber, which means both the fiber count and the net-carb figure can overstate reality. Regulatory treatment of it has tightened in some markets for exactly this reason. If IMO is high on the ingredients list, mentally discount the fiber claim.
The five-second label check
Turn the bar over. Find where the fiber is coming from in the ingredients list.
Dates / nuts / oats near the top - trust the number, expect it to be modest.
Chicory root or inulin - real fiber, start with half a bar.
Soluble corn fiber - real fiber, usually fine.
IMO or "isomalto-oligosaccharide" - discount the claim.
What a good bar looks like
Rather than ranking specific products that reformulate every year, here's the spec worth shopping against:
- 5g+ fiber, 10g+ protein. Enough of both to be worth eating instead of two separate things.
- Fiber from a source you can name as a food. If you can point at the ingredient in a supermarket, it's whole-food fiber.
- Under ~10g of added sugar. Many "healthy" bars are confectionery with protein powder in.
- Short ingredients list. Not a health rule exactly, but a strong correlate of whole-food fiber.
- No sugar alcohol pile-up. Maltitol and sorbitol have their own digestive consequences, and stacking them with 12g of inulin is asking for trouble.
Categories that tend to fit: date-and-nut bars (whole-food fiber, moderate protein), oat-based bars, and the better seed bars. Categories that tend not to: anything marketed primarily on net carbs, and anything advertising a fiber count that would be impressive in a bowl of beans.
The honest comparison
Half a cup of black beans is roughly 7-8g of fiber and about 7g of protein for a fraction of the price of any bar, and the fiber is intact, varied, and arrives with the food matrix that makes it behave well. A bar cannot beat that nutritionally. What it beats is nothing, which is what you'd otherwise have eaten in a car or between meetings.
That's the correct frame for the whole category. A bar is a gap-filler for the days food doesn't happen, and judged that way a good one is genuinely useful. Judged as a replacement for eating plants, it's an expensive way to consume manufactured fiber. If bars have been wrecking your stomach
- Check for inulin or chicory root first. It's the cause the overwhelming majority of the time.
- Halve the dose. Literally half a bar, twice a day, for a week. Tolerance builds.
- Check for sugar alcohols too. Maltitol and sorbitol produce very similar symptoms, and a lot of bars contain both those and inulin.
- Switch to whole-food fiber. A date-and-nut bar with 6g of real fiber will treat you better than a 15g manufactured one.
- Drink water with it. A dry bar with 12g of fiber and no fluid is a bad combination.

Counting them honestly
The practical problem with bars is that the number on the wrapper is the number people log, and for IMO-heavy bars that number is optimistic. If you're tracking intake, it's worth treating whole-food fiber as fully counted, chicory and corn fiber as counted, and IMO with scepticism - or just preferring bars where the question doesn't arise.

Frequently Asked Questions
Is the fiber in protein bars real fiber?
It depends on the source. Fiber from dates, nuts, oats and seeds is intact whole-food fiber and behaves exactly as you would expect. Chicory root inulin and soluble corn fiber are genuine fibers, though extracted and manufactured rather than eaten in food form. IMO, or isomalto-oligosaccharide, is the questionable one - research indicates a substantial portion of it is digested and absorbed like a sugar rather than reaching the colon as fiber, so bars relying on it can overstate both their fiber content and their net carb figure.
Why do high-fiber protein bars make me bloated?
Usually chicory root inulin, which is completely fermented by gut bacteria with gas as the byproduct. A bar delivering 12g of inulin in ninety seconds is a large fermentation load arriving all at once, which is not how the gut is accustomed to receiving fiber. Sugar alcohols such as maltitol and sorbitol produce very similar symptoms, and many bars contain both. Check the ingredients, start with half a bar, and consider switching to a bar whose fiber comes from whole ingredients.
How much fiber should a good protein bar have?
Around 5-10g from a source you can identify as a food is a better target than the 15g figures on heavily engineered bars. A bar with 6g of fiber from dates and almonds is generally doing more for you than one with 15g from manufactured fiber, because you will actually tolerate it and the number is honest. Pair that with at least 10g of protein and under about 10g of added sugar and you have a genuinely useful bar.
Are protein bars a good way to hit a daily fiber target?
They are a reasonable gap-filler and a poor foundation. Half a cup of beans costs far less, delivers comparable fiber and protein, and provides varied intact fiber along with the nutrients that come attached to real food. The right way to use a bar is for the days when a proper meal is not going to happen, where the alternative is eating nothing useful at all. Building a daily fiber target primarily out of bars is expensive and less effective than eating plants.
